Remember that your credit standing today affects your financial life tomorrow. This means if you have defaults on credit cards and other payments, banks would consider you a high risk. When the time comes that you need a bank loan for a mortgage or a new car, you may have a hard time getting approved because of your poor credit history. It is smart, then, to do what you can to keep your credit history in good standing.
Fortunately, there are now many debt management services that you could seek help from. They offer different services ranging from simply giving debt advice to even negotiating with your creditors for better loan repayment terms.

Consider going for debt counseling that could help you find options. Most of these services do not charge for the first visit, and most do not ask for an upfront fee to handle your case. You would have to be transparent, reveal all your debts and the way you manage your financial life so that they could advice you better.
Finding a good debt counseling service is possible through the use of the Internet. You could ask for online quotes, compare the cost and the benefits of their services. Once you have made your choice, be sure to explain your whole situation. Ask questions, explore options and follow their advice. You may have to break some bad spending habits in order for your financial situation to improve.
